No Touch means No Touch: There is zero tolerance for adjusting D82 or D95 orders under any circumstances! Simply, there are no circumstances were we want you to adjust the order.
Faced, but not Full: Walmart’s practice of just-in-time delivery thru CAO supplies enough inventory to cover it’s OSA requirement, but not enough to necessarily pack out the shelves and displays like we’re used seeing as a DSD organization. In some cases (not all), you will need to get used to shelves/displays not being as packed out as if you had adjusted the order.
Trust, Patience & Open-mindedness: The adjustments that you were previously making to the order to maintain safety and demand stock levels are different than that of Walmart CAO system. I know it feels counterintuitive to the issues that some of you are experiencing today, but we need you trust the process and the system.

Attached Please Find Frequently Asked Question & Answers

My store is NOT receiving a CAO order?

Most likely this store is currently sitting at 33 day-of-supply (DOS) and receives a delivery Wednesday and Friday. CAO can’t meet the 40 cases minimum because most items already have enough product to maintain safety stock and demand until the following delivery on Wednesday

How does CAO generate an order?

CAO will only order to maintain safety stock (3.5 DOS or 20% shelf capacity) and meet the demand forecast between deliveries (based on 7 years sales history and recent sales trends)
CAO is only going to generate an order if it can get to 40 cases

Action: Do not write an order. Focus on correcting On Hand Inventory to ensure order accuracy.

Can I still write orders for D82 items not on the MOD? No! For the integrity of the process, you will not be allowed to adjust orders for D82. You will not be able to order product for Pick Pack and Snack, Go Cups, Barnum Racks, etc.

What if my store has never received a CAO Order? Please submit the store number and issue here

What about New Stores, should I order for them? Yes. New stores will not generate CAO order. The SR will need to manually write orders for these stores until they begin to see CAO orders in the tablet.

Can we still ship PRDs? No. PRDs will not be ordered by CAO and should not be orders by SR’s.

Do I need to order product for the Category Fixture? Displays settings are in place to maintain 3 sides of the Category Fixture based on the July POP. Display setting and the shelf settings will not keep the displays FULL but should send enough product to maintain both locations. The 4th Side of the Category Fixture will not be maintained by CAO.

What do we do when a store does not meet MOQ? CAO will not generate an order less than 40 cases. The branch threshold for Walmart deliveries is 40 cases. All branches should deliver all Walmart orders regardless of the MOQ. If CAO generates an case order that only has 30 cases, it will pull 10 cases from a subsequent order to bring the order to 40 cases. If for some reason CAO cannot get the order to 40 cases, it will skip the order.

How do we handle credits? Nothing has changed for the credit process. Credits should be written as usual.

How do we handle inventory? What is recommended process? SR’s should use the existing CAO order and call customer care to adjust the order date as agreed to with the store. The SR can also call customer care to cancel the order and let CAO adjust on its own order.

Will Customer Care allow us to cancel an order for a Store Inventory? Yes.

Do we need dummy orders to attach NOS orders in system? No. NOS’ need an order to attach to. If CAO has not sent an order, the NOS will have to attach to the next available order in the system before it expires.

Can I adjust an order DOWN if it is too much product? Walmart has asked that we not touch the order. If there is too much shipping at once, please have the store open a Remedy Ticket to resolve.

Is it okay to communicate the “No Touch” to Walmart store personnel? Yes. This is a Walmart initiative and can be discussed with store personnel as appropriate.

Can I still order Cardboard/POS? Yes, the SR will need to create a separate order with just the POS needed
